Future Wedding: Tyler & Ashley

Introducing Tyler and Ashley! We can’t wait for these two to say “I DO” on April 10, 2021! 

How/When did you two meet?

We met in Physical Therapy school at our class Halloween party. Tyler was dressed as Napoleon Dynamite and I was a biker, what a match. After a few months of saying hi in the hallways, he asked me on a date and we’ve been together since!

How did Tyler propose? 

Tyler proposed in Palo Duro Canyon. After hiking all day, we got dressed up and went out to dinner. Then, we returned to the canyon at sunset where Tyler had a photographer waiting to capture the moment! This place is extra special because its where we took our first trip together when we first started dating.

Why did you choose The French Farmhouse Venue? 

We wanted a venue that was timeless, and somewhere our guests would enjoy celebrating as much as we will. Visiting the French Farmhouse gave us a glimpse of everything we could hope for in a venue, and can’t wait to see it come to life on the day of. 

What are you most excited about for your big day? 

We are most excited to begin building a life together as we start our careers, and one day a family!

 

Future Wedding: Cade and Paige

Introducing Cade and Paige! We are so excited for these two to say “I Do” at The French Farmhouse Venue on June 26, 2021.

Where/how did you meet?

Cade and I have been friends since we were in preschool — my mom says I have been calling Cade my boyfriend ever since. When we got into high school our friendship grew a little faster than others in our friend group. In December of our Junior year of high school, Cade spontaneously asked me on our first date, a trip to see the Christmas lights on the Frisco Square. It didn’t take long for either of us to realize that we wanted more than a simple friendship, so we began dating on December 18, 2014.

How did he propose?

Our proposal was along-awaited moment for just about anyone who knows us. On June 23, 2020, Cade asked me on a date to Red Lobster. When he arrived to pick me up, he was holding roses and champagne glasses, not typical for a date to Red Lobster. When we walked out of the front door of my house, there was a picnic set up on the backside of the tank on my family land. By the grace of God, the rain had let up for about an hour that day, the hour in which Cade popped the question. It was a very cherished and intimate moment, just the two of us, our fur baby, and our parents who came out from the house shortly after.

Why did you pick The French Farmhouse Venue?

It is hard to explain exactly why we chose the French Farmhouse. It is kind of like falling in love – when you know you know. There was a very specific moment on our tour when we had our “this is the one” moment. We had just been shown up to the grooms suite and were headed back down he stairs. When we reached the bottom of the stairs, we looked up and were able to get a view of the entire interior of the venue – it was breath taking. The owners have truly put love and thought into ensuring that each intricate detail is selected to be of significance to couples.


What are you most excited about getting married?

We are most excited to begin tackling the journey of life together, officially. We have weathered a lot of change in our relationship, but this change has got to be the most exciting one. Beginning June 26. 2021, we will be growing as one – facing challenges together, celebrating triumphs together, mourning together, making memories together, traveling together, and most importantly, growing in God together.

 

Future Wedding: Audrey & Colton

Introducing Audrey and Colton! We can’t wait for these two to say “I DO” on June 20, 2021!


Where/how did you meet?

Audrey:
At the beginning of my sophomore year, my best friend (and future maid of honor) invited me and some girls over to her house for a get-together. She also happened to invite a guy she knew from high school and his roommates. Lucky for me, one of his roommates ended up being incredibly attractive. Myself and said roommate talked and ended up two-stepping in her kitchen by the end of the night. Colton and I went on to be close friends (who definitely had serious crushes on each other) until we began dating later that year.

Colton:
Before my sophomore year of college, I was moving into an apartment complex when my roommate ran into a friend from high school in the stairwell. She was also moving into the complex and invited us over for a game night with friends. I remember my roommate being very reluctant to go, but I insisted because she “might have hot friends.” So we went and met everyone there, but my eyes were set on the most beautiful girl in the room. We got the chance to spend time together and by the end of the night we exchanged phone numbers and the rest is history.

How did he propose?

He knocked it out of the park! He knows I love surprises, so he made sure to do everything behind the scenes with help from our amazing families. The story was that we were meeting at his Aunt and Uncle’s land to leave from there for a nice dinner with his family. I showed up to his apartment after he got off work to head south to Waxahachie and he had gotten me Lilies “just because” and I was none the wiser. Looking back, he was doing many things that revealed his nerves such as dropping keys and missing exits despite being a human compass, but I was oblivious. Upon arrival, I was told everyone was running late. He took me to admire an old wagon on the land before leading me down to the most beautiful setting of blankets, flowers, pictures and hanging tea lights when I finally realized what was happening. He had a poem written about us and our story that we read together and the last line asked if I would marry him. He was on one knee and said some words neither of us can truly remember and I can’t remember if I audibly said yes or just vigorously nodded my head. We popped champagne, laughed, cried, took it all in and Colton prayed over us before then finding out our immediate family members were there to celebrate us. It was one of the best days of my life so far.

Why did you pick The French Farmhouse Venue?

We felt like everything about the venue resembled us. The size was perfect for what we needed and the land was absolutely beautiful. We loved the antique accents and how much apparent thought and care was put into every detail. Kelsey and Michelle were extremely helpful with every question and truly made us feel like friends from the moment we met. We toured while it was still under construction, so Kelsey really helped in ensuring we could visualize what the final product would look like. We did tons of research for venues around the DFW area and felt sure the moment we left The French Farmhouse Venue after visiting that it was where we wanted to make and celebrate our covenant to each other.

What are you most excited about getting married?

Audrey:
I am so excited to get to do life with my best friend forever! He is the person I love most in the world and the fact that I get to build a home and a legacy with him still blows me away. Life is going to be so much fun.

Colton:
In the past 4 years that I have known Audrey, we have grown tremendously in all walks of life including with each other. If so much has changed in 4 years for the better, I can’t wait to see what a lifetime will bring.
